Spring quarter classes

HUMBIO 4A: The Human Organism

Organ system physiology: the principles of neurobiology and endocrinology, and the functions of body organs. The mechanisms of control, regulation, and integration of organ systems function.

HUMBIO 4B: Environmental and Health Policy Analysis
Connections among the life sciences, social sciences, public health, and public policy. The economic, social, and institutional factors that underlie environmental degradation, the incidence of disease, and inequalities in health status and access to health care. Public policies to address these problems. Topics include pollution regulation, climate change policy, biodiversity protection, health care reform, health disparities, and women's health policy

BIO 22N: Infection, Immunity, and Global Health

Preference to sophomores. The causes and prevention of infectious diseases, focusing on the interplay between pathogens and the immune system that determines the outcome of the disease. Introduction to microbiology, immunology, and epidemiology. Diseases of the past and present, including TB, malaria, AIDS, and Ebola. The roles of biological, environmental, and societal factors in disease emergence, spread, and prevention. Primary scientific literature, student-led discussions, and research projects.

CHEM 36: Organic Chemistry Laboratory I
Techniques for separations of compounds: distillation, crystallization, extraction, and chromatographic procedures. Lecture treats theory; lab provides practice.

Winter Quarter Class

HUMBIO 3A: Cell and Developmental Biology

The principles of the biology of cells: principles of human developmental biology, biochemistry of energetics and metabolism, the nature of membranes and organelles, hormone action and signal transduction in normal and diseased states (diabetes, cancer, autoimmune diseases), drug discovery, immunology, and drug addiction.

HUMBIO 3B: Behavior, Health, and Development

Research and theory on human behavior, health, and life span development. How biological factors and cultural practices influence cognition, emotion, motivation, personality, and health in childhood, adolescence, and adulthood. 

CHEM 131: Organic Polyfunctional Compounds
Aromatic compounds, polysaccharides, amino acids, proteins, natural products, dyes, purines, pyrimidines, nucleic acids, and polymers.

PWR2DH: 

P-Sets, Essays and Midterms: Making Time for Social Change in a Busy World

Are you a member of one or more of Stanford's 650-plus student groups and see yourself using your career to address social inequities? Or are you too busy doing p-sets, writing papers, playing a sport and/or studying for midterms so you can graduate with a well-paying job in these financially unstable times? Or are you trying to find ways to do all of the above?

In this course, we'll be focusing on two aspects of these scenarios. First, we'll be exploring whether it is possible, likely, or even desirable for students and professors to focus their work on "fixing" the social ills of the world. That is, what might be the costs and benefits of university researchers also being advocates and taking their work off their computers and into the "streets"? Second, we'll be investigating ways your education can contribute to your ability to advocate for social change, whether you have service as a career goal or find it challenging to combine your day-to-day studies with your interests in social change.

To do this, we'll be developing our website, Re+Action, to connect your research with on- and off-campus organizations who may be interested in putting your research to work. We will also examine debates about research, activism, and scholar activists, as well as the relationship between research and service. We'll study and maybe even talk with professors like Ruthie Gilmore, Rob Reich and Joan Petersilia to see how they couple their research with advocacy, as well as with students who choose to become Stanford Public Service Scholars. Finally, our time will be spent watching oral presentations by people like law professor Larry Lessig, award-winning former PWR 2 students as well as by performing several of your own.

Fall Quarter Classes

CHEM 35: Organic Monofunctional Compounds

Organic chemistry of oxygen and nitrogen aliphatic compounds.

POLISCI 3P: Justice (ETHICSOC 171, IPS 208, PHIL 171, PHIL 271)

Focus is on the ideal of a just society, and the place of liberty and equality in it, in light of contemporary theories of justice and political controversies. Topics include protecting religious liberty, financing schools and elections, regulating markets, assuring access to health care, and providing affirmative action and group rights. Issues of global justice including human rights and global inequality.

HUMBIO 2A: Genetics, Evolution, and Ecology
Introduction to the principles of classical and modern genetics, evolutionary theory, and population biology. Topics: micro- and macro-evolution, population and molecular genetics, biodiversity, and ecology, emphasizing the genetics and ecology of the evolutionary process and applications to human populations.

HUMBIO 2B: Culture, Evolution, and Society

Introduction to the evolutionary study of human diversity. Hominid evolution, the origins of social complexity, social theory, and the emergence of the modern world system, emphasizing the concept of culture and its influence on human differences.

Spring Quarter Classes

CHEM 33: Structure and Reactivity

Organic chemistry, functional groups, hydrocarbons, stereochemistry, thermochemistry, kinetics, chemical equilibria.

CHEMENG 25B: Biotechnology (ENGR 25B)

Biology and chemistry fundamentals, genetic engineering, cell culture, protein production, pharmaceuticals, genomics, viruses, gene therapy, evolution, immunology, antibodies, vaccines, transgenic animals, cloning, stem cells, intellectual property, governmental regulations, and ethics. Prerequisites: CHEM 31 and MATH 41 or equivalent courage.

IHUM 73B: Ultimate Meanings: Decoding Religious Stories from around the World

Is there more to life than survival, or does it have some higher purpose? Why is there suffering, death, and evil in the world, and is there some way to overcome them? Religious communities often answer such questions through the art of story-telling, through history, myth, biography and other forms of distilling human experience into narrative. These stories have shaped the world we live in, helping people to cope with difficult aspects of experience, influencing the way we love, suffer and die, inspiring the imagination, and helping to ignite conflict and violence.\n\nThis course introduces you to some of the great stories of the world's religions¿the sacred narratives of Buddhism, Judaism, Christianity and Islam. We will read these stories to learn something about the religious cultures that produced them, and how they have shaped human experience.\n\nIn the winter quarter, students will be introduced to stories drawn primarily from the Buddhist tradition in the many forms which it developed as it spread across Asia from India to Japan and beyond. We will look at the biography of the founder, the Buddha, the tales of his previous lives, the stories of his disciples, and of later saints and heroes, religious practitioners and ordinary folk. Students will learn to read these stories to see how they elaborate a persuasively constructed world of meaning in terms of which people can make sense of their own personal histories.\n\nIn the spring quarter, the focus will shift to the foundational narratives of Judaism, Christianity and Islam¿the stories of the Israelites¿ exodus from Egypt, the suffering Job, the life and death of Jesus and the calling of the prophet Muhammad. Do these stories have only one meaning, and who determines what that meaning is? Can a story's meaning change over time, and if so, what do such stories mean today, in a partially secularized culture very different from the ones that produced them? We will address these questions by exploring how these ancient stories have been re-imagined by recent thinkers and writers who can help us understand how their meaning has changed¿or is changing¿in the light of modern experience

MATH 20: Calculus

Continuation of 19. Applications of differential calculus; introduction to integral calculus of functions of one variable, including: the definite integral, methods of symbolic and numerical integration, applications of the definite integral.
